WebJun 7, 2024 · Hi, You can file an injured spouse claim in TurboTax. Form 8379 lets you (the "injured spouse") get back your portion of a jointly-filed refund if it's seized or offset to pay your spouse's debt.. You must file jointly to use this form.Also, filing an 8379 will delay your federal refund by up to 14 weeks. To file this form in TurboTax: 1. Open your return. WebBy filing Form 8379, the injured spouse may be able to get back his or her share of the refund. Some examples of legally enforceable debts are as follows: Child or spousal support. Overpaid unemployment compensation that has been ordered to be returned. State income tax. Past due federal tax.

WebJan 13, 2024 · An innocent spouse filed a joint return, but was unaware that their spouse deliberately under-reported their tax liability. By filing as an innocent spouse (Form 8857), they can be protected from additional taxes, penalties, and interest when the IRS later finds out about the unreported income. A couple can file Form 8379 along with their joint tax return if they expect their refund to be seized. Alternatively, the injured spouse can file it separately from the return if they find out after …
